Apt

如何使 apt 讀取不同的 sources.list

  • January 31, 2018

我正在嘗試為我的使用者安裝程序,因為我沒有 sudo 權限。

我嘗試dos2unix按如下方式安裝軟體包:

apt-get source dos2unix 
./configure --prefix=$HOME/myapps
make
make install

但我收到以下錯誤:

E: You must put some 'source' URIs in your sources.list

由於我無法編輯 sources.list,有沒有辦法讓 apt-get 讀取另一個文件?

可以使用 another sources.list,正如muru指出的那樣,它很簡單

apt -o "Dir::Etc::sourcelist=/path/to/your/sources.list" source dos2unix

文件表明,除非在配置文件中,否則這是不可能的,但事實證明文件是錯誤的(請參閱配置文件變體的修訂歷史記錄)。

或者,如果包在修訂控制系統中維護,您可以直接複製包源。apt showsrc dos2unix節目

Vcs-Git: https://anonscm.debian.org/git/collab-maint/dos2unix.git

所以如果你已經git安裝了,你可以複製它。debcheckout,在devscripts包中,可以為您自動執行該操作,但您可能沒有安裝它…請參閱如何在 debian 中了解包的源儲存庫?詳情。

引用自:https://unix.stackexchange.com/questions/420905